    Navigare reacted to Martin A. in Member Map   
    You can unpack the .tar file and upload the content to /applications/, like we used to prior to IPS4. Unpacking the .tar will give you a folder named "membermap", this is what you'll upload. Make sure you overwrite existing files.
    That should give you an upgrade prompt in the ACP, if not you'll have to manually navigate to http://siteurl/admin/upgrade.
    Not a supported solution, but should work.
